摘 要:为了提高印刷品的质量以及对墨斗结构进行优化,分析了墨斗辊上不同参数条件对油墨流动特性的影响。建立了不同参数条件下的油墨流场的数学模型,并进行了仿真计算,得到了油墨在墨键开口大小处的速度分布情况。结果表明:油墨流速与墨斗刀片夹角和墨斗辊转速有关;墨斗刀片夹角和墨斗辊的转速都和墨键开口处油墨流量成正比关系。In order to improve the quality of printing product and optimize the structure of ink fountain,the influence of different parameters conditions at ink fountain roller on the flow characteristics of ink was analysed,he mathematical model for ink flow field under different parameters conditions was established,simulation calculation was performed and the speed distribution of ink at ink key opening side was obtained.The results show that the flow rate of ink is related to the blade angle of ink foundation and revolving speed of ink fountain roller,and the blade angle of ink foundation and revolving speed of ink fountain roller are both directly proportional to the ink flow at the ink key opening.
